Emperor – Battle for Dune

Guide updated 19th December 2025.

Frank Herbert’s seminal sci-fi novel Dune is set in a science fiction universe where computers are religiously outlawed due to an artificial intelligence led rebellion. Conventional warfare with guns, projectiles and explosives is obsolete due to the invention of impenetrable, wearable force-fields. It’s fair to say then, that most of the Dune computer games take some artistic license with the source material. Emperor – Battle for Dune is the sequel to the genre-defining Dune II. The game was generally well received, but criticised by some for failing to innovate or move the genre forward in any meaningful way. Nevertheless, if you hanker for some old-school RTS action and prefer the sci-fi setting of the desert planet Arrakis to the battlefields in Command and Conquer, then then Emperor – Battle for Dune is unlikely to disappoint.

Installation

When we last visited this game in 2017 we remarked on how difficult it was to get working on modern computers due to it’s use of an outdated copy protection mechanism. While we were able to coax the game into running back then, unfortunately that wasn’t the case for our new Windows 11 machine. The game would install, but stubbornly refuse to run.

Fortunately, however, the internet has come to the rescue once again, thanks to a completely new installer and patch written by one Tom Mason. The patch (along with extensive notes for anyone curious as to what it took to fix this old game) can be downloaded here.

To use the launcher, simply extract it to any suitable empty directory on your PC and run “EmperorLauncher.exe”. The program will then install the game to wherever you placed it. We recommend using a directory such as C:\Games\Emperor, not the “Program Files” or “Program Files (x86)” folder.

If you have an installation of Emperor Battle for Dune already, note that you need to uninstall it and reinstall it using the launcher. You can keep any save games you’ve made in the past though.

Installing Emperor Battle for Dune.
In this screenshot we are Installing the game to E:\WESTWOOD\Emperor. If you have an old install of the game, uninstall it first.

Once the game is installed, you can start it by running the “EmperorLauncher” program again. The updated installer even adds multiplayer capacity back into the game.

Tweaking graphics settings

Graphical settings are now all configured by EmperorLauncher and we do not recommend changing them. This game launched in the year 2001, so even a budget PC can comfortably run it on maximum graphical quality settings.

If you’re planning to play the game on your HDTV rather than computer monitor, you might want to run the game at a lower screen resolution since the games text is very small when running in higher resolutions. Rather than changing the resolution in-game (which no longer works) set your desktop to the desired resolution before starting the game. Running in a lower resolution will, of course, result in less detailed graphics, but at least game text is then legible.

Multiplayer and other notes

The internet multiplayer service for Emperor – Battle for Dune shut down a long time ago. However, the new patch from Tom Mason should re-enable this, if you can find anyone to play with.

You can also play over your local network with other PCs in your home by selecting LAN mode. The patch also restores the co-op campaign mode, which for some reason could only be played over the internet before.
